Besides the plaza and monument to the guerrilla commander Ernest Che
Guevara, without doubt the most important attraction in central Cuba,
highlights of the capital city include the Museum of the Battle of
Santa Clara – liberated through the forces of Che Guevara against the
president Batista - , the Vidal Park and various surrounding buildings,
such as the Teatro de la Caridad, the hotel Santa Clara Libre and the
Museum of Decorative Arts. On its periphery the hotel Los Caneyes, an
imitation of a native village, and the Villa La Granjita are important
centers of tourism. ![]() Villa La Granjita The Santa Maria Key, with its magnificente four-star beach hotel, is
joined to the land by a road over the sea, which offers the traveller
who loves nature unforgettable untouched scenery where beautiful flora
and fauna can be seen. A journey over this route is an pleasant
experience that culminates in enjoyment of other lovely beaches in the
north of Cuba.
![]() Cayo Santa María Along the route from the capital to the keys one encounters the city of Remedios, one of the best conserved Cuban urban centers, with the architecture and mood of the XVIII y XIX centuries. It is also famous for its traditional festivals that are extremely lively. Caibarién is also along this route and it is here that one can eat fresh seafood and enter the Fragoso Key with its paradisiacal beach.
